Overview Of Heating And Cooling Systems
Heating and cooling systems come in several core configurations, including central air conditioners, furnaces, heat pumps, and packaged units. Central air uses a furnace or air handler paired with an outdoor condenser, delivering conditioned air through ductwork. Heat pumps provide both heating and cooling by transferring heat rather than generating it, offering high efficiency in moderate climates. Ductless mini-split systems install without ducts, making them ideal for renovations or zones with irregular layouts. Understanding how each system distributes comfort helps readers interpret reviews more accurately.
Key Features To Consider In Reviews
When reading reviews, focus on performance metrics, reliability indicators, and user experience. SEER (Seasonal Energy Efficiency Ratio) measures cooling efficiency, while HSPF (Heating Seasonal Performance Factor) assesses heating efficiency for heat pumps. Look for units with ENERGY STAR certification, which signals efficiency and potential savings. Comfort features such as variable-speed blowers, inverter-driven compressors, smart thermostats, and quiet operation can significantly affect daily living. Reviews often highlight installation ease, noise levels, and response times from customer support.

Energy Efficiency And Operating Costs
Efficiency metrics translate directly into yearly operating costs. A system with a higher SEER or HSPF generally reduces electricity consumption, especially during peak cooling days. Real-world savings depend on insulation, duct sealing, thermostat controls, and usage patterns. Reviews often clarify expected runtime, maintenance needs, and the impact of variable-speed components on energy bills. Homeowners should request a precise energy-use estimate based on their home’s square footage, climate, and current insulation levels.
Installation, Sizing, And Ductwork
Proper sizing and professional installation are critical to system performance. Oversized units cool or heat quickly but waste energy and shorten equipment life; undersized units struggle to reach target comfort levels. Reviews frequently note issues arising from improper load calculations, duct leaks, or insufficient airflow. An accurate load calculation by a qualified contractor and duct sealing can prevent common problems. Consider asking for a detailed installation plan, refrigerant line sizing, and confirmation of proper refrigerant charge during commissioning.

Maintenance, Warranty, And Service
Maintenance needs vary by system type. Regular filter changes, coil cleaning, and annual professional inspections help sustain efficiency and longevity. Reviews value transparent warranties covering parts, compressor reliability, and labor, along with straightforward terms for routine maintenance. Service experience matters: responsive support, readily available replacement parts, and clear communication during repairs contribute to higher ratings. Homeowners should track service intervals and verify coverage specifics in writing.
Common Issues Highlighted In Reviews
Frequent concerns include compressor or fan motor failures, refrigerant leaks, thermostat connectivity problems, and escalating energy bills despite minimal usage. Noise complaints often relate to outdoor condensers or ducted systems with improper mounting. Reviews may also point to recurring maintenance costs or delays in service. By weighing these issues against the system’s reliability history, readers can gauge risk and plan for potential repairs or replacements.

Practical Decision-Making Guide
To apply review insights, homeowners should:
- Obtain multiple bids and compare recommended systems against a documented load calculation.
- Prioritize models with high efficiency, favorable warranty coverage, and positive field performance.
- Consider climate-appropriate choices, such as heat pumps with auxiliary heat in colder regions or ductless systems for retrofit projects.
- Evaluate installation quality and post-purchase support as much as upfront cost.
- Plan for maintenance scheduling and budget for periodic tune-ups and filter replacements.
